Groupoid Quantization of Loop Spaces

High Energy Physics - Theory 2012-03-28 v1 Mathematical Physics math.MP

Abstract

We review the various contexts in which quantized 2-plectic manifolds are expected to appear within closed string theory and M-theory. We then discuss how the quantization of a 2-plectic manifold can be reduced to ordinary quantization of its loop space, which is a symplectic manifold. We demonstrate how the latter can be quantized using groupoids. After reviewing the necessary background, we present the groupoid quantization of the loop space of R^3 in some detail.
